An exciting opportunity has arisen for a highly motivated individual to join our Inpatient Medical and Surgical team as a Band 3 Physiotherapy Assistant. This role offers the chance to work alongside our team of Physiotherapists. Experience as an Assistant or in healthcare would be ideal, but is not essential.

This position may be undertaken as a secondment, subject to approval from your current line manager.

The Inpatient Medical and Surgical team is proactive in providing a holistic service, working within a multidisciplinary team to ensure patients receive high-quality interventions, achieve their rehabilitation goals, and are safely discharged in a timely manner.

Good communication and time management skills are essential to operate effectively within a busy inpatient environment across various settings. Training and a competency package are included in the role.

At Barnsley, we offer clinical supervision, staff support, professional development opportunities, and a supportive working environment.

You will be joining us at an exciting time as we review and improve our service delivery and implement digital solutions to benefit both patients and staff.

Barnsley is conveniently located near the major cities of Sheffield and Leeds, and borders the scenic Yorkshire Dales and Peak District National Park.

Main duties of the job

Implement therapy programmes delegated by the Physiotherapist to aid patient rehabilitation.

Manage your own caseload, under supervision or independently, treating patients according to set protocols, monitoring progress, and reporting any changes to the Therapist.

Carry out clinically relevant administrative duties to ensure smooth service delivery.

Participate in a comprehensive induction and access ongoing learning and development opportunities.

Contribute to service development and improvement, shaping effective patient care pathways and best practices.

The successful candidate will have excellent teamwork skills, strong interpersonal and communication abilities, and the capacity to work both collaboratively and independently.

Flexibility in working hours is essential, including potential 7-day and weekend shifts.
